In this episode we speak with Kristin Grayce McGary (LAc., MAc., CFMP®, CST-T, CLP) and explore functional blood work—a deeper, more holistic way of interpreting lab results. Instead of just looking for illness, functional testing helps us understand where the body may be out of balance, often long before symptoms become serious. From nutrient deficiencies and hormone imbalances to hidden inflammation and Stress markers, functional blood work can be a powerful tool for creating truly personalized health plans.

Cathy Biase is a Holistic Nutritionist and Certified Professional Cancer Coach. She received her Bachelor of Science from the University of Toronto at St. Michael’s College, majoring in Psychology. She is a graduate of the Canadian School of Natural Nutrition and received her cancer coaching certification from the National Association of Professional Cancer Coaches.

Cathy specializes in the functional application of nutrition for root cause health improvement in the area of chronic disease with a focus on cancer care.

Cathy has appeared on television and at speaking engagements educating people on topics such as nutritional support for cancer patients, managing side effects of allopathic cancer care, the Microbiome and its links to health, immune support, improving gut health and cancer coaching. As well, she is the host of The Health Hub, a radio talk show and podcast covering various aspects of integrative health.

Cathy’s education along with her personal journey through a cancer diagnosis has given her a profound understanding of how vitally important proper Nutrition and Lifestyle are to achieving optimum health.
